Niiice Was but the room turned into a furriness hitting 47Degrees, the A/C units are shit anyone any recommendations on cooling that doesnt involve proper DC grade heat extraction and recovery? Its not hard, work out how much power (energy) you are pulling out and then get the equivalent amount of cooling power. Heres some ideas to get you going: Heat is measured in either British Thermal Units (BTU) or Kilowatts (KW). 1KW is equivalent to 3412BTUs. Most aircon units are measured in BTU's so I'll work in that unit. Equipment BTU = Total wattage for all equipment x 3.5 Room Area BTU = Length (m) x Width (m) x 337 Lighting BTU = Total wattage for all lighting x 4.25 There seems to be no windows, or people working in there permanently so you can probably leave those calculations out. Total Heat Load = Room Area BTU + Windows BTU + Total Occupant BTU + Equipment BTU + Lighting BTU So you need enough aircon cooling to handle that amount of heat. I'd say on equipment alone you would need minimum 100KW or 350K BTU's of cooling It only appears that you have two of them, thats max 50K BTU if you have the most powerful (25K BTU) wall-split units, so you would need 14 of them. Assuming this will be delivered in 4 months from now, consider that in the last month LTC difficulty went up by 58%. If this continues you're looking at 1/6 of current revenue per MH/s in October, all other things being equal. So the $2000 price tag is roughly equivalent to $10-12k being asked for the current Innosilicon hardware. Of course "all other things" are never equal, so do your own math based on your own data/estimates/beliefs/rumors/etc.
